Preparing and writing a report
Forensic accountants are often called upon to produce a written report, documenting their observations and conclusions. The content and structure are important and likely will be subjected to scrutiny.
Attend this webcast — part one of a two-part series — to learn the different types of forensic reports, how the report should be structured and how to avoid pitfalls when preparing a report.
Key Topics
- Statement on Standards for Forensics Services
- Report structure
- General considerations
- Best practices in report writing
- Pitfalls to avoid
Learning Outcomes
- Recognize the different types of forensic reports and the applicable standards
- Identify important elements that should be included in the report
- Recall potential pitfalls facing forensic accountants
